Dubai: Dubai Municipality Contact Centre has received more than 73,000 notifications on different issues from customers and the general public during the first half of this year.

According to the centre, the concerned sections can accomplish more than 94 per cent of the notifications within the specific time period, said Khalid Abdul Rahim, director of the Customer Relations Department of the Municipality.

He also said that out of 73,110 notifications received at contact Centres, 68,404 were accomplished within the specific time period, and out of this figure 50,000 services were carried out freely with a total expenditure of Dh20 million.

Most of the notifications are received online through a system that is designed according to the nature and style of the Municipality’s customers.

Once a customer is registered in the system he or she will receive a notification code by SMS and can add and follow up on this notification regularly.
